1· struts2中的session和servlet中的session的區別和聯絡?
其實struts2中的session和servlet中的session沒有本質的區別,struts2本質上還是乙個servlet,只是struts2對其進行了封裝。在struts2中開發,只需要新增一些東西就可以完成,而無需像servlet那樣從頭開始寫。但是前者就需要使用時進行配置。
2· struts2中的返回結果型別有哪些?
1) redirect 4) dispatcher7) steam
2) redirectaction5) freemaker8)plaintext
3) chain 6) httpheader等等
3· struts2中的action是單例還是多例?
是多例的,每乙個請求都會產生乙個新的action,這樣才可以保障多執行緒的環境下互不影響,否則會出現資料可以互相看見的問題。擴充套件:在spring中是預設單例模式的,可以在bean中配置scope=「prototype」。
在需要提高效能時,可以配置為單例項的。
面試總結 高階JAVA工程師
一 無筆試題 不知道是不是職位原因還是沒遇到,面試時,都不需要做筆試題,而是填張個人資訊 或者直接面試 二 三大框架方面問題 1 spring 事務的隔離性,並說說每個隔離性的區別 解答 spring事務詳解 2 spring事務的傳播行為,並說說每個傳播行為的區別 解答 spring事務詳解 3 ...
面試總結 Java高階工程師(一)
不知道是不是職位原因還是沒遇到,面試時,都不需要做筆試題,而是填張個人資訊 或者直接面試 1 spring 事務的隔離性,並說說每個隔離性的區別 解答 spring事務詳解 2 spring事務的傳播行為,並說說每個傳播行為的區別 解答 spring事務詳解 3 hibernate跟mybatis ...
面試總結 Java高階工程師(一)
不知道是不是職位原因還是沒遇到,面試時,都不需要做筆試題,而是填張個人資訊 或者直接面試 1 spring 事務的隔離性,並說說每個隔離性的區別 解答 spring事務詳解 2 spring事務的傳播行為,並說說每個傳播行為的區別 解答 spring事務詳解 3 hibernate跟mybatis ...